This is a relaxing and fascinating adventure that culminates with a stay at the unique Jungle Rafts, located right on the River Kwai and surrounded by towering jungle. Escape frenetic Bangkok and head west towards the Burmese border, visiting the Thai-Burma Railway Museum and the cemetery for Allied POWs en route.
Walk along the famous Bridge on the River Kwai before taking a long tail boat ride through unspoiled mountain scenery. Visit nearby ethnic Mon tribal village, historic Hellfire Pass and ride the notorious Death Railway before retuning to Bangkok.
Grading for tour is moderate to adventurous
Day 1... Visit the Museum, War Cemetery, and Bridge over the River Kwai. Board long-tail boats bound for the unique Jungle Rafts and visit a nearby ethnic Mon village.
Day 2... After breakfast explore the historic Hellfire Pass and ride the Death Railway before returning to Bangkok.
